Etymology
[edit]Compound of 口 (kuchi, “mouth”) + 溶け (toke, 連用形 (ren'yōkei, “stem or continuative form”) of the verb 溶ける (tokeru, “melt”).). The toke changes to doke as an instance of rendaku (連濁).
